North Korea, a country of eastern Asia. It occupies the northern part of the Korean peninsula, between the Sea of Japan on the east and the Yellow Sea on the west.
After World War II ended in 1945, the Korean Peninsula became divided. In the North, the Communists announced the formation of the Democratic People's Republic of Korea on September 9th, 1948.
